My walk to work #BEDM day 5

Walking to work doesn’t happen as often as it used to. That’s because the whole family life routine has changed a bit, and so now sometimes I drive because it’s faster than taking public transport.

I like the public transport though. At least, I generally do, if I can get a seat. Standing up on a tube train in the early hours isn’t always so much fun…but whatever happens, I get the opportunity to relax, to read, to watch the world speed by for a bit before I sit down at my desk and get on with the day.

And when I’m walking from the station to the office, there is always something new to notice.

Sometimes, I see the sand dog man. He makes dogs out of sand. At least I say dogs, it’s actually really ‘dog’ I suppose because he only seems to know how to sculpt a labrador. Every time I see him I wonder ‘is this the day he’ll surprise me with a pug? Or an Alsatian? Or perhaps a Chihuahua? But so far…no. Always the labrador.

Then there are the paintings. New paintings are springing up on walls everywhere. They are bright and colourful, and although they stay the same I am always noticing new things about them.

Most recently, there are the flowers. This time of year is wonderful for a bit of colour on the walk to work – there are daffodils, there are tulips, and there are other flowers I don’t know the name of because myself, I am not really a friend to flowers (I cannot grow them, but I like to look at the results from those who can).

Driving to work really doesn’t have the same feel to it. There are no sand dogs. There are no paintings. There might be flowers, but mostly there are just other cars and endless tarmac until I reach the office.

Walking to work makes for an interesting start to the day.
